Hand over
Hand over verb - To give (something) over to the control or possession of another usually under duress.
Usage example: the police officer ordered the suspect to hand over his weapons
Yield
Yield verb - To give (something) over to the control or possession of another usually under duress.
Usage example: refusing to yield the city to enemy troops
Hand over is a synonym for yield in keep topic. You can use "Hand over" instead a verb "Yield", if it concerns topics such as relinquish, give in.
